President-elect Donald Trump announced plans to impose a 25 percent tariff on goods from Canada and Mexico .
Trump said the policy would help stem the flow of immigration from both countries.
As the U.S. 's nearest neighbors, Mexico and Canada are its two largest trade partners, with Mexico trading the equivalent of $798,835 million in 2023 .
